Affiliate marketing is a revenue sharing arrangement between the product developer, known as the affiliate merchant, and the affiliate marketer who is anyone that’s willing to encourage the sale of product by advertising the product using any identify of legal means available.
The relationship will allow the affiliate merchant to grow their revenue by paying only for the
advertising that results in a sale. The affiliate marketer will profit by making a proportionality on a
sale that he does not have to manage after the sale.
Getting paid
Getting paid every depends upon how the affiliate program is set up. Some merchants will separate their own affiliate program. They’ll have special types of software that assigns each affiliate marketer
a special link that’s used in promoting the product. The software will track sales of every marketer
and the merchant will clear the commission on a periodic basis using either PayPal or another method of payment.
